You are right in your remark about the path to images, Wolfgang. I was not
using any

\setupexternalfigure[location=default]

instruction. With your formulations the figure is recovered without problem.

Unfortunately the results of your rewrite of the macro are not so
satisfactory. Surely it is more *ConTeXt*ual than mine but it fails to
fulfill the main purpose of the exercice: it happily prints fleurons in
blank pages, as running your tests with 6 lines demonstrates. In such a
circumstance it should produce just two pages with six lines each, whereas
it outputs 4 pages, the two additional ones containing only ornaments.
